My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:


Bailey is my wife's dog. She got her from a Facebook Rescue group who posted they were going to be euthanized unless adopted. She is almost 3. She raised her in an apartment with another roommate. She got lots of attention and loves to cuddle and spend time with you. She also loves to play and run around. She is trained to use a potty pad. She will go outside but she's a bit confused on when to let us know and often just uses the pad

I own a German Shepherd. My GS is very high energy and she plays too aggressively with the smaller Bailey. This has lead Bailey to become very scared of her and run away, which triggers my dog's prey drive and it gets out of control quickly. We have to keep Bailey pinned up because both dogs are very independent and my GS tries to sit on her and lay on her which causes her to freak out and snap at my GS. The GS retaliates and we just can't make them get along.

We feel guilty and want Bailey to have a higher quality of life than staying pinned up.
